数据类型在设计表结构时至关重要,选择合适的数据类型可以有效节省存储空间并提高运算效率。Oracle数据库中的数据类型主要包括字符型、日期/时间型和大对象(LOB)型。
Oracle数据类型详解及学习文档下载
相关推荐
Oracle学习文档指南
Oracle学习文档,零基础学习,帮助用户从基础开始掌握Oracle相关知识。通过本指南,您将能够逐步了解Oracle的核心概念与实用技能。
Oracle
0
2024-11-04
Oracle 数据类型详解
Oracle 数据库管理系统支持丰富的数据类型,用于存储和管理不同种类的数据。以下是一些常用的 Oracle 数据类型:
数值类型
NUMBER: 用于存储整数和浮点数。
INTEGER: 用于存储整数。
FLOAT: 用于存储浮点数。
字符类型
CHAR: 用于存储固定长度的字符串。
VARCHAR2: 用于存储可变长度的字符串。
日期和时间类型
DATE: 用于存储日期和时间信息。
TIMESTAMP: 用于存储带有时区信息的日期和时间。
LOB 类型
BLOB: 用于存储二进制大对象,如图像和视频。
CLOB: 用于存储字符大对象,如长文本。
其他类型
BOOLEAN: 用于存储布尔值 (TRUE 或 FALSE)。
ROWID: 用于存储行的唯一标识符。
Oracle
3
2024-05-27
Oracle数据类型详解及SQL语句解析
Oracle的数据类型包括定长字符型Char(size),可变长字符型Varchar2(size),数字型Number(m,n),日期类型Date,以及二进制大对象Blob和文本大对象Clob。每种类型在SQL语句中都有具体应用场景。
Oracle
0
2024-10-01
Oracle学习文档中的主键约束详解
主键约束是在表中创建一个唯一标识每一行的列或列组合,确保其唯一性并防止包含空值。每个表只能有一个主键,它可以定义在表级或列级。在Oracle学习文档中,通过创建PRIMARY KEY约束,可以为表添加主键。例如,创建部门表时,可以使用如下语法:CREATE TABLE departments (department_id NUMBER(4), department_name VARCHAR2(30) CONSTRAINT dept_name_nn NOT NULL, manager_id NUMBER(6), location_id NUMBER(4), CONSTRAINT dept_id_pk PRIMARY KEY(department_id)); 注意:PRIMARY KEY约束会自动创建一个唯一索引。
Oracle
2
2024-07-27
Oracle学习文档的插入方法详解
隐式插入方法示例:在省略字段列表时,使用INSERT INTO departments (department_id, department_name) VALUES (30, 'Purchasing'); 显式插入方法示例:在VALUES子句中显式指定NULL关键字,例如INSERT INTO departments VALUES (100, 'Finance', NULL); 这些方法都是学习Oracle数据库操作时的基础内容。
Oracle
2
2024-07-31
启用约束的oracle学习文档
使用ENABLE子句可以启用表中定义的当前禁用的完整性约束。执行ALTER TABLE employees ENABLE CONSTRAINT emp_id_pk时,将自动创建UNIQUE或PRIMARY KEY索引以启用相应的UNIQUE键或PRIMARY KEY约束。启用约束意味着所有表中的数据必须符合约束条件。对于带CASCADE选项的主键约束,其禁用不会影响任何依赖于该主键的外键。
Oracle
0
2024-08-09
定义约束续-Oracle学习文档
定义约束(续)
列级约束:只涉及一个单个的列,对于该列用规范定义;能够定义完整性约束的任何类型:t column[CONSTRAINT constraint_name] constraint_type表级约束:涉及一个或多个列,表中的列被分别定义;除了NOT NULL,能够定义任意约束:column,...[CONSTRAINT constraint_name] constraint_type(column, ...)相关视图:USER_CONS_COLUMNS,USER_CONSTRAINTS。
Oracle
0
2024-10-31
Oracle学习文档连接运算符详解
在WHERE子句中,连接运算符用于将多个表达式组合成复合条件判断。常见的连接运算符包括AND和OR。当AND连接的两个表达式都为TRUE时,AND运算符返回TRUE;而OR连接的两个表达式中任意一个为TRUE时,OR运算符即返回TRUE。
Oracle
0
2024-09-27
Simulink数据类型详解及MATLAB教程
Simulink支持所有MATLAB内置数据类型,并额外支持布尔类型。在Simulink模型窗口的Help菜单下选择Block Support Table,可以查看每个Simulink库模块支持的数据类型详细信息。
Matlab
0
2024-08-17